LinearBackoff
Defined in: src/retry/backoff-strategy.ts:96
Linear backoff: delay grows as baseMs * attempt, capped at maxMs, then jittered.
Implements
Section titled “Implements”Constructors
Section titled “Constructors”Constructor
Section titled “Constructor”new LinearBackoff(opts?): LinearBackoff;Defined in: src/retry/backoff-strategy.ts:101
Parameters
Section titled “Parameters”| Parameter | Type |
|---|---|
opts | LinearBackoffOptions |
Returns
Section titled “Returns”LinearBackoff
Methods
Section titled “Methods”nextDelay()
Section titled “nextDelay()”nextDelay(ctx): number;Defined in: src/retry/backoff-strategy.ts:107
Returns the delay in milliseconds before the next attempt.
Must be a non-negative finite number. Implementations should treat
ctx.attempt < 1 as a programmer error.
Parameters
Section titled “Parameters”| Parameter | Type |
|---|---|
ctx | BackoffContext |
Returns
Section titled “Returns”number